"Peaceful"
Overall Resort Rating:
Nightlife is perfect if you want to relax and enjoy the peace and quiet. Food and drink was excellant quality and a good price at Fois and Dom Spiros. Muses was overpriced and Acropolis - well I would give it a wide berth - but then again many people went everynight - Microwaved frozen food doesn't do it for me. Best beaches Avithos and Ammes. Ammes is at the end of the run way- a fasinating place to be on Tues and Sun watching the planes coming in.

"Svoronata"
Overall Resort Rating:
Svoronata is a traditional village, and very spread out. It is quiet, so don't expect much nightlife, and either hire transport, or expect a fair walk! There are a number of beaches, all very good and quiet (even early September). Prices were high, but no more so than the rest of Kefalonia now - partly the exchange rate, but seems more expensive than some islands. We generally found the restaurants good, with friendly staff. There is a limited bus service to the rest of the island, but it is easy to hire a car if you want.
There is a path we found towards the end of the holiday - next to the restaurant/cafe with a racing theme (have forgotten the name!) which links through to come out uphill from the Astra village - which varied the route a bit.
We found the proximity of the airport added to the fun of the holiday rather than a distraction.
